(March 29, 2026) Macalister reports that this inscription was found on a small bronze strip 3 4/5" long by 1/2 wide. It was found while excavating a mound on this townland. The antiquities found within it were of such a heterogeneous nature that they must have been by chance in the earth before it was heaped up as they could not possibly have been contemporary elements of one single archaeological group.
The object is now in the collection of the Royal Irish Academy, housed in the National Museum.
